WebTip 3: Always use a shaving gel or cream. Shaving without a gel or cream can be very irritating to the skin and ultimately lead to razor bumps. Look for a gel or cream that matches your skin type. If you have sensitive skin, find one specifically made for sensitive skin. Some gels and creams also contain aloe or oatmeal as an ingredient which ...
